I had decided that the front flower beds needed to be filled out some more, so picked up two cone flower plants this spring. I know these will spread, and eventually I'll have to split them up and relocate into different beds, but I like the cream color instead of the traditional purple. The finches love the cone flower seeds, so I don't dead head my plants even though they can look kind of ugly after awhile. I can put up with that to draw the beautiful yellow birds.
